Sindoor is a 1980 drama that explores the nuances of love and sacrifice, set against the backdrop of traditional Indian values. The pacing feels deliberate, allowing the weight of each character's choices to settle. The performances are quite visceral, with actors conveying deep emotional currents that reflect the societal expectations of the time. There's a rawness to it, particularly in the moments of conflict and reconciliation, that gives it a very unique flavor. While the director remains unknown, the film’s atmosphere is thick with tension and longing, making the quieter scenes just as impactful as the more dramatic ones. The practical effects and setting are modest but add to the authenticity of the narrative, immersing you in that world.
